The Manufacturing Process: How It Works

So, how are these parts made? The process begins with creating a mold, which is then filled with molten metal. Once cooled, the mold is removed, revealing a meticulously crafted part. This method allows for intricate designs and strong materials, ensuring that each component meets stringent quality standards.
